Substrate feeder Definition:

  • Substrate feeders are animals that live in or on their food source.

Substrate feeder Explanation:

Substrate feeders dwell in or on their food source. Leaf miners are tiny substrate-feeding insects that tunnel their way through leaves. Termites are substrate feeders that destroy wooden structures by burrowing through the wood, feeding on the cellulose. Leaf miner caterpillar, the larva of a moth, eats through the soft tissue of an oak leaf, leaving a dark trail of feces in its wake. Other substrate feeders include maggots (fly larvae), which burrow into animal carcasses.

